I Am Awesome! Lesson Plan

Help 3rd-grade learners recognize and celebrate their unique strengths to build self-esteem and confidence through individualized activities.

Boosting self-esteem in young students can improve their classroom engagement, resilience, and success in academics and personal growth.

Welcome to I Am Awesome!

Welcome the student warmly. Explain that today's session is about recognizing all the special things about them. Ask them to share one thing they like about themselves to start the conversation.

Your Strengths

Guide the student through reflecting on their personal strengths. Use the provided questions if the student needs help coming up with ideas. Encourage them to write or share verbally.

You Are Awesome!

Wrap up the session by reviewing the strengths the student mentioned. Reinforce their positive qualities with an affirmation. Encourage them to remember this feeling whenever they need a boost.
